Simply Sweat Sauna just had their grand opening last month. WBBJ 7 Eyewitness News anchor Ariana Alexa met with the owner from Humboldt who started the business with her husband.
Ashley Childs, owner of Simply Sweat, says the infrared sauna studio has four colorful sauna pods that go up to 175 degrees. Sweat sessions last from 30 to 40 minutes.
“Sweating is the body’s healthy and natural way to detox all of the toxins we accumulate to heal and stay healthy,” Childs said.
It’s really simple. All you have to do is come in, make sure your time and temperature are set, lift the pod, then lie down, relax and sweat it out.
Childs says it’s good for arthritis, bone and joint pain, clear skin and even sports recovery.
If you are hesitant to try out these steamy pods, Childs says don’t fret.
“Your head is outside the bed the whole time, which allows you to still be able to breathe, so you’re not feeling the heat suffocating feeling that traditional saunas may give you,” Childs said.
Simply Sweat offers several membership and package plans. They also take walk-ins.
